This is just bizarre. Some guy is charging $40 a year for a service that bills itself as a 'Document storage and "Rapture" triggered email messaging system.' Yes, six days after the rapture, your loved ones will get the ultimate spam. Check out the You've Been Left Behind site. Perhaps they could tie in a system that would place Amazon orders for Left Behind to be sent to your friends as final gifts. After all, how will the credit card company collect from you?
